I can appreciate any 67-72 GM truck, whether its stock, resto-mod or full blown custom.
But, what I tend to gravitate to more is a 3" or 4" static drop front and a 5" - 6" rear static drop with a stock height bed floor with no major modifications. One because its just real world drivable. Whether its to the local hangout or across country to a relatives graduation (or any other road trip). Plus, That way the nexy guy (If its ever sold) can change whatever they want without being stuck with "that huge C-notch" or Welded in Air-Bag mounts, etc... I am not saying that a C-notched raised Floor Air-Bag truck isn't cool. But I just kind of feel "personally" that a unmolested stock frame and body work done right is way cool.
